Why Are Korean Conglomerates Scaling Up Hiring in India?

India now hosts a large and growing base of Global Capability Centers (GCC), and industry data puts the current workforce in the millions, with continued growth expected through 2030 as centers mature from execution outposts into full product, AI, and engineering hubs. Korean names are showing up on that list with increasing frequency, not just as manufacturing or retail operations, but as engineering and R&D hubs.


Samsung and LG built their India presence on consumer electronics manufacturing and are now layering software, semiconductor design, and AI R&D teams on top of it. Krafton, the publisher behind BGMI and PUBG, entered India in 2019 and has since become one of the country's most active gaming investors, running a full studio and product team out of the country rather than treating it as a satellite market. Hyundai Mobis and the broader Hyundai group are pushing into EV battery software and ADAS engineering, and several of those teams are being staffed through India rather than Korea, because Bengaluru and Pune already have the embedded systems and cloud engineering density that Seoul's tighter labor market cannot supply fast enough.


What shows up on the ground is a two speed problem. Korean headquarters move fast on capital allocation, sometimes clearing a multi trillion won domestic investment plan in a single quarter, but move slowly on people decisions outside Korea because nobody on the Seoul side owns the compliance risk of hiring in India.


Which Indian Cities Offer the Right Talent for Korean GCC and EOR Teams?

For the roles Korean companies are hiring right now (embedded and firmware engineers for EV and IoT, semiconductor verification engineers, cloud and backend engineers for gaming backends, and data engineers for AI teams) talent concentration is not evenly spread across India, and treating it that way is the most common mistake in Korean hiring briefs.


Bengaluru remains the deepest pool for cloud, backend, and AI/ML talent, and it is also where Samsung's own R&D Institute and a growing number of semiconductor design teams already sit, so engineers there are used to working inside a Korean reporting structure and Korean quality review culture.


Pune and Chennai carry the strongest embedded systems and automotive software talent in the country, with Chennai's dense automotive supplier ecosystem overlapping well with Hyundai and Hyundai Mobis' EV software needs.


Hyderabad has become the reference city for semiconductor verification and chip design engineers, built on a decade of investment from global chip companies that trained a large bench of engineers Korean semiconductor teams can now tap directly.


What Indian engineers bring to Korean mandates reliably: strong fundamentals in distributed systems, cloud infrastructure (AWS and Azure dominate over GCP in the Indian market), and genuine comfort working async across a large time zone gap, since most have already worked with US or European clients.


What often needs specific screening on Korean mandates is exposure to Korean documentation and code review conventions, which tend to be far more structured and sign off heavy than the Silicon Valley style Indian engineers are used to, plus familiarity with the compressed, high context communication style common in Korean engineering teams. A live pairing round with a bilingual or Korea experienced reviewer before any candidate reaches the client interview stage has been the single filter that prevents the most first 90 day exits on Korean accounts.


What Legal Rules Should South Korean Companies Understand Before Using EOR in India?

The starting point for any Korean company evaluating this model has to be the Payment of Gratuity Act, 1972, and the Employees' Provident Fund and Miscellaneous Provisions Act, 1952, because these two statutes, not Korea's own Labor Standards Act, govern the actual employment relationship once an engineer is on Indian payroll. The Gratuity Act applies to companies, shops, and establishments employing 10 or more workers, and mandates a gratuity payout of 15 days' wages for each completed year of service, payable after five years of continuous service.


Under India's labour code reforms, the definition of "wages" has been tightened so that basic pay, dearness allowance, and retaining allowance together must equal at least 50 percent of total CTC, a change that directly increases both the mandatory PF contribution base and the eventual gratuity payout, since both are calculated off that wage component rather than gross CTC.


The mistake seen most often from Korean headquarters new to India is structuring an offer as an allowance heavy, low basic package to keep headline CTC competitive, without realizing that under the new wage definition this no longer reduces statutory cost the way it once did, and can trigger a compliance gap if the 50 percent threshold is not met. A reputable Indian EOR handles this restructuring automatically, but the Korean finance team still needs to understand why the employer cost line moves even when the offer letter number stays flat.


The second recurring issue is permanent establishment risk. If a Korean company directs the day to day work, sets KPIs, and effectively manages Indian engineers as if they were direct employees while technically routing payroll through a contractor arrangement rather than a compliant Employer of Record (EOR) structure, Indian tax authorities can argue a permanent establishment exists in India, creating exposure to Indian corporate tax on activities the Korean headquarters assumed were purely an offshore cost center.


A properly structured EOR removes this ambiguity because the EOR entity, not the Korean company, is the legal employer of record for statutory purposes. Contract Hiring or Full Time Hiring: Which Model Fits Korean Teams Expanding into India?

Contract hiring and full time hiring solve different problems, and Korean teams often default to whichever model they use back home without checking whether it fits the work in India.


Contract hiring works well for defined, time bound engagements: a six month cloud migration, a regulatory compliance sprint tied to a wage code deadline, or a proof of concept for a GenAI feature. It gives a Korean team specialized expertise fast, without a long term headcount commitment, and it is increasingly common across Indian GCCs for exactly this reason, since hiring a full time employee for work with a defined endpoint rarely makes economic sense.


Full time hiring, run through an EOR rather than a direct entity, is the better fit for core, ongoing roles: the backend engineer maintaining a live gaming service, the firmware engineer embedded in a long running EV platform, or the verification engineer who needs to build deep product context over years, not months.


For South Korean companies approaching EOR in India as their entry model, the practical approach is to map each open role against its expected duration first.


A six month deliverable goes to contract hiring. A role central to the product roadmap goes to full time hiring through the EOR, with entity conversion considered later once the team stabilizes.


How Does an EOR Process Work for Korean Companies Hiring in India?

A typical Korean EOR mandate runs in three phases.

Weeks 1 to 2 cover role scoping with the Korean hiring manager, usually over a Korea adjusted call slot since KST is only 3.5 hours ahead of IST, one of the easier overlaps to manage compared to US or European clients, plus EOR entity onboarding paperwork.

Weeks 2 to 4 cover sourcing and technical screening, including the bilingual reviewer pairing round for engineering roles.

Weeks 4 to 5 cover the offer, background verification, and EOR managed onboarding, with the engineer live on Indian payroll and reporting into the Korean team by day 30 to 35.


One mandate stands out. A mid size Korean gaming company, roughly 400 employees globally and expanding its India presence beyond an existing Bengaluru studio, needed four backend engineers for a live ops team within six weeks, ahead of a major title update. All four were placed inside 32 days.


What almost went wrong: the client's Seoul finance team had structured the offer letters with basic pay at roughly 35 percent of CTC, well below the threshold required under India's revised wage definition, to match a Korean style low basic, high bonus structure.


The issue was flagged during offer letter review, before release, since going out as drafted would have promised a take home figure that statutory restructuring would then have reduced, creating a compliance mismatch discovered only after signing. The offers were restructured to basic pay at 50 percent of CTC, the difference was added back through a structured allowance, and all four engineers started on schedule with correctly compliant contracts.


What Does It Cost to Hire Engineers in India Through an EOR?

Real numbers, not percentage ranges. These reflect current India market rates for the embedded, backend, and semiconductor adjacent roles Korean companies are hiring most.

Level

Experience

Annual CTC (₹)

Approx. equivalent (₩, indicative)

Mid level Software or Embedded Engineer

4 to 6 years

₹18 to 24 lakh

₩29 to 40 million

Senior Engineer (Backend, Cloud, Firmware)

7 to 10 years

₹32 to 45 lakh

₩53 to 74 million

Lead Engineer or Architect

10+ years

₹55 to 75 lakh

₩91 to 124 million

On top of CTC, a Korean company should budget for employer EPF contribution at 12 percent of basic wages, gratuity provisioning at roughly 4.8 percent of basic salary (accrued monthly even though paid out only after five years or on exit), and the EOR service fee, which typically runs 10 to 15 percent of CTC or a flat per employee monthly fee depending on the provider and headcount.


For an Indian contract hire, the day rate equivalent for a senior engineer in this bracket typically comes in at 45 to 55 percent of what the same role costs as a full time contractor placement out of Seoul or Singapore, once employer statutory costs are counted on both sides. FAQs

1.Does India's Payment of Gratuity Act apply to Korean engineers hired through an Indian EOR?

Yes. Once an engineer is on the payroll of an Indian EOR entity employing 10 or more workers, the Gratuity Act, 1972 applies exactly as it would to any Indian employer, regardless of where the parent company is headquartered. The EOR becomes the statutory employer for compliance purposes, so gratuity accrues from day one at roughly 4.8 percent of basic salary and becomes payable after five years of continuous service, or earlier on death or disability. Korean labor protections do not carry over.


2.Which Indian cities have the deepest cloud infrastructure talent for Korean gaming and EV software teams?

Bengaluru leads by a wide margin for cloud native and Kubernetes heavy roles, followed by Pune and Hyderabad. For Korean gaming backends specifically, Bengaluru's talent pool overlaps with major existing studio hiring, which has trained a generation of engineers on live ops, matchmaking, and real time backend systems. For EV and embedded adjacent cloud roles, Pune and Chennai carry stronger overlap with automotive systems experience.


3.How do Korean companies handle IP ownership when an engineer is employed through an Indian EOR?

IP assignment is written into the employment agreement between the EOR entity and the engineer, with a back to back agreement assigning all work product to the Korean client. This is contractually equivalent to direct employment IP assignment under Indian law, but it needs to be drafted explicitly. A generic EOR template without a client specific IP clause is the most common gap found in agreements sourced independently by Korean legal teams.


4.Does India's wage code change how Korean companies should structure basic pay in offer letters?

Yes, materially. Under the revised wage definition, basic pay, dearness allowance, and retaining allowance combined must equal at least 50 percent of total CTC. Korean companies used to a low basic, high variable bonus structure need to restructure India offers to meet this threshold, because PF and gratuity are calculated off the wage component, not gross CTC. Getting this wrong can shift the take home figure an engineer was promised before they even start.


5.What is the realistic timeline for a Korean company to have its first India based engineer working, using an EOR?

Three to five weeks from a confirmed offer, assuming the EOR partner is already onboarded on the Korean company's side. That includes background verification, EOR employment agreement execution, and payroll setup. This compares with four to six months for setting up a wholly owned Indian entity from scratch, which is why most Korean companies use EOR for their first 5 to 20 hires.


6.How do Korean semiconductor companies vet Indian verification and chip design engineers before hiring through EOR?

Beyond standard technical screening, a documentation and communication style assessment specific to Korean semiconductor teams is run, since the sign off heavy, highly structured review culture common at large Korean chipmakers differs meaningfully from the more informal code review norms Indian engineers are used to from US headquartered clients. Candidates are paired with a Korea experienced reviewer for a live technical round before reaching the client.


7.Can a Korean company terminate an EOR employed engineer in India as easily as it could in Korea?

No. Termination in India is governed by the employment contract, applicable state Shops and Establishments Act provisions, and, depending on structure, India's Industrial Relations Code. Notice periods, severance obligations, and documentation requirements are typically more protective of the employee than Korea's own labor framework in practice, and a compliant EOR will insist on documented performance issues, a proper notice period, and full and final settlement including gratuity if eligible.


8.Do Korean companies need a local bank account or Indian entity to pay engineers through an EOR?

No, and this is the core advantage of the model. The EOR entity holds the Indian bank account, runs Indian payroll, and invoices the Korean company in a single consolidated invoice, payable from Korea via standard cross border wire. This lets a Korean company have engineers legally employed and paid in India within weeks, without first navigating India's foreign investment and company registration process.
